Stunt doubles?


I know Burt Lancaster did his own stunts as he really was an acrobat before he became a movie star. What about Tony Curtis? It sure looks like he's doing his own , but does anybody know for sure.

reply

The stuntdouble for Tony Curtis was my uncle Alessandro Nava. We just called him Sandro. He was born on the 9th November 1929 (I think), and he was italian, but he was born in Germany. His family had a circus, so he grew up as an acrobat.

His career as an acrobat stopped when he injured his arm very bad. I'm not really sure when that was.. He spoke english, italian, french, spanish, german, danish, swedish, and a little arabic.
